CVE-2024-5098
low-risk
Published 2024-05-19
A vulnerability has been found in SourceCodester Simple Inventory System 1.0 and classified as critical. Affected by this vulnerability is an unknown functionality of the file login.php. The manipulation of the argument username leads to sql injection.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. The identifier VDB-265081 was assigned to this vulnerability.
